The two demons walked faster and faster. Although they had risen to the rank of high-ranking demons in Hell, they were not famous demons recorded in the human world. Therefore, their strength was much lower than that of famous demons. For example, Balthazar, the scoundrel demon who often looked down on this and that at the Midnight Daddy Club, had mocked the two of them many times.

Only hybrid demons can set foot in the human world. They descend by using the bodies of two unlucky humans, which further weakens their strength. They then encounter someone who seems to possess the abilities they have.

We must be extremely careful.

"See if that Asian guy is catching up," Hawke said in a low voice.

Demon Barton continued walking forward, saying, "Why don't you just look back yourself? I never look back; it's beneath my style."

Demon Hawk: "..."

He had known Patton in Hell for over two hundred years, and this was the first time he had ever heard of it in this style.

Just then, a gentle voice came from behind: "What's the big deal? We can tell just by listening to the voice."

Hawke and Barton were jolted awake, and like stressed wildcats, they darted out, spitting a mouthful of thick saliva towards the source of the sound, causing the ground to sizzle and crackle.

Where are the people?

They were completely baffled. They were absolutely certain they hadn't been hallucinating; there must have been someone there!

But when he turned around, there wasn't a soul in the dimly lit alley.

Just then, something shocking happened to them.

The shadow of Barton the Devil on the ground suddenly twisted a few times, and the young man who had just been seen at the club entrance rose from the shadow and stood completely in front of him.

Humans could not possibly possess this ability!

Patton was absolutely certain!

It tried asking, "You have an Asian face, and you don't look like a demon from hell. May I ask your name so we can know which district you're from..."

Li Xuan calmly said, "I'm not very famous here, but I am indeed someone who frequents hell."

Barton breathed a sigh of relief, a smile spreading across his face. "Oh, I see. We thought you were a hybrid angel. It's good that you're one of us..."

Li Xuan: "They're not one of us."

The two demons were silent for a moment, feeling that this "one of their own" was a bit difficult to deal with. But then they thought about it, and realized that Hell was full of intrigue and backstabbing, and demons had to fight demons. If a demon wasn't difficult to deal with, it would have been dead long ago.

Li Xuan said, "I need to go to the mental hospital where Mammon was born. Do you have a car? Take me there."

As he left the club, the black notebook reminded him that he didn't have much time left in this world. He could choose to return to the real world early or automatically return when his time ran out.

When you come to the world of Constantine, how can you not see the classic scenes?

If Satan is so powerful, could he possibly chase after me into the real world and come after me? If he really has such incredible torque, Li Xuan would naturally have to accept the unexpected defeat.

The demon Barton sensed a faint malice emanating from Li Xuan, making him somewhat reluctant to travel with him. Moreover, Mammon, the son of the demon, had his own demon followers.

They are clearly not included in this list, otherwise they would have gone to the hospital to offer their loyalty long ago.

Barton hesitated for a moment and said, "We don't..." Whoosh!
Suddenly, a jet-black longsword appeared, slicing past the tops of their heads and cutting into the right wall of the alley!
Li Xuan gripped the hilt of his long sword with his right hand, scratched the back of his head with his left, and chuckled, "So, I've been presumptuous enough to interrupt your journey?"

The already disharmonious atmosphere instantly froze.

Patton hesitated for a moment before finally managing to say, "I have a Nissan Axle, is that alright?"

Hawke quickly chimed in, "Oh yes, yes, it has a car."

Patton immediately cursed Hawke's ancestors to the eighteenth generation in his mind. What did he mean by having a car? Hawke had a Rolls-Royce and a Ferrari.

……

The Rolls-Royce's headlights pierced the darkness of the night.

The jet-black, streamlined car sped along the road like a ghost...

The car was unusually quiet.

Li Xuan spoke first: "You two seem to be high-level demons. Are you original demons or fallen demons? Could you tell me in detail about your experience of becoming demons?"

Patton, driving with a long face, said, "Our experience is not honorable, and we're afraid it will spoil your enjoyment."

Li Xuan waved his hand and said, "It's alright, I like hearing about shameful stories, as long as they're true..."

Patton hesitated for a moment, as if resigned to his fate, and said, "My real name is Matthew Patton. I was born in 1850, a time when there were constant disputes in the United States and the conflict between the North and the South over slavery was becoming increasingly serious."

Ordinary people have a hard life. My childhood was filled with chaos. The days that followed seemed to be filled with running around. Later, I went to work on the railway, but soon many Asians came and there were conflicts. Because I had some Asian ancestry and my face didn't look very American, I was knocked unconscious with a stone while I was sleeping at night, mistaken for an Asian.

When I woke up, I felt despair for America and for the world. I picked up a sharp object and slit my throat. I never imagined that hell really existed. Because I committed suicide, I was not accepted by heaven, so I naturally went to hell.

Hell is far more cruel than the human world; the looting, killing, and occupation exceed the limits of any demonic event I could imagine as a human being.

I learned something: demons are not immortal. When they are killed in hell, they die completely and become nourishment for other demons.

To extend their lifespan, demons must devour other demons, or... devour fresh human souls. The latter can greatly increase their lifespan limit and strength. If they could devour humans with spiritual power, that would be a huge temptation for every demon...

However, Satan and God made a bet that they could only redeem and tempt humanity indirectly.

Therefore, the supply of human souls in hell has plummeted, making souls a precious currency, more expensive than ever before...

Demons devour each other to prolong their lifespans, but this doesn't increase their power, so they naturally know it's not a solution. Therefore, they devise various methods to lure humans into corruption through dreams and contracts, allowing them to unite with humans and give birth to bodies that can perfectly contain the demon's true form. They then use this method to enter the human world and purchase souls.

Hawke and I were in similar situations; he died because his wife left him for another man, and in a fit of rage, he committed suicide.

We started as the lowest level of carrion monsters, those monsters with a desiccated appearance and only half a head, who instinctively devoured the souls that fell from the sky.

The role of the carrion demon is to punish the souls of humans who have fallen into hell. They are not actually absorbed by us; they will be reborn and fall again and again until a real demon comes to harvest them.

Our comical performance finally caught the interest of a demon, who tossed us some fragments of his soul. This gave us independent consciousness, allowing us to know what we were. From then on, we followed this demon, feeding on its scraps, waging wars to seize territory, and slowly becoming the lowest-ranking demon in terms of combat power…
